Athletistic/ Figure skating. Last weekend the fourth stage of the Figure Skating Grand Prix took place in Kazan. Figure skater Kamila Valieva was in the lead after the short program, but finished fourth. The controversy was caused by one of the elements in which the judges found a fall. Russian figure skater Betina Popova spoke about this.
– She touches the ice with her hip. But it’s not even that critical – there was also contact during skate testing. The question is about controlled movement, I remember this rule while dancing. If during training the judges notice that the movement is done in the same way, then there are no questions. Here it was clear that there was a loss of balance, which resulted in a deduction. Nastya Mishina usually lay down on the ice, but this was not a fault, but a planned move. No chattering or twitching. Yes, you can say that’s what you wanted, but they’ll tell you that you were hanging out. One hundred percent fall, everything is extremely simple and objective,” SE quoted Popova as saying.
